1. See this rock formation on a red cliff known as The Dixie Sugarloaf

The Dixie Sugarloaf, St. George, Utah
Source: Photo by Flickr user Ken Lund used under CC BY-SA 2.0

Whether driving by in your car or getting out for a closer look, you should snap a photo at this site, which has been part of the city for years. This attraction also comes with a history where in the past, sugar was one of the goods that no one in Dixie had access to, so this massive rock structure made of red sandstone was named “Sugarloaf” as a symbol of the fact that they finally obtained some of this treasured commodity.

Initially, the students from the class of 1913 at Dixie Academy painted the year “1913” to give it a memorable appearance; however, later on, they covered it up with large white letters that indicated the word “DIXIE” as a tribute to the place.

3. Learn about dinosaurs at St. George Dinosaur Discovery Site at Johnson Farm

The St. George Dinosaur Discovery Site at Johnson Farm
Source: Photo by Flickr user 5of7 used under CC BY-SA 2.0

St. George Dinosaur Discovery Site at Johnson Farm is a relic site and gallery exhibiting trace fossils from the Early Jurassic. It’s home to thousands of footprints from dinosaurs that existed nearly 200 million years ago. A trip to the establishment is both fun and educational, as you see and learn about history and important events that took place. You’ll be attended to by a dedicated staff that goes out of their way to ensure a worthwhile tour. In addition, there’s a well-stocked gift shop that you can visit for souvenirs and presents.

5. Tour Red Hills Desert Gardens

Echinocactus grusonii, Red Hills Desert Garden, St. George, UT, USA
Source: Photo by Wikimedia Commons user Kip Robinson used under CC BY-SA 4.0

Red Hills Desert Garden is a 5-acre (2 ha) botanical garden with over 5,000 desert plants, dinosaur tracks, and a replica slot canyon. It’s a beautiful and well-kept garden, therefore, a great place to learn about the desert ecosystem. Additionally, you get to enjoy panoramic views of the city from the garden’s viewpoints. There’s also a stream that’s home to endangered fish species like Virgin Chub and Spinedace.

7. Take a tour of Western Sky Aviation Warbird Museum

Editor's Note: Photo taken from the establishment's official social account

Posted by Western Sky Aviation Warbird Museum on Sunday, July 5, 2020

Situated at St. George Regional Airport, this museum is committed to preserving, repairing, and exhibiting aircraft for educational purposes. A visit to this establishment teaches you about aviation history and the sacrifices made by servicemen and women in wars such as World War One, World War Two, and the Vietnam War. You can also take a guided tour around the facility with the help of a knowledgeable and friendly tour guide. If you like history and anything to do with aircraft, then this place will excite you.

8. Visit Brigham Young Winter House

Brigham Young Winter Home, St. George, Utah
Source: Photo by Flickr user Ken Lund used under CC BY-SA 2.0

Designed by Miles Park Romney, this establishment is a historic residence and museum located in the heart of St. George. The house was a former residence of Brigham Young, a renowned American religious leader. Get a glimpse of the past and learn about the area by walking around the home or indulging in a guided tour. Inside the house are antique furniture and other collections that are well preserved and beautifully displayed. It’s also a great spot for family photos.
